Summary

Notre Dame hosts Rice this Saturday in a non-conference college football game. The Irish enter the matchup following their season opener, with coaching staff looking to expand the involvement of the wide receiver group. Analysts identify Mylan Graham as a potential candidate for increased receiving yards, aiming to establish him as a secondary target alongside Jordan Faison. The Notre Dame defense aims for a shutout, relying on a deep roster of high-rated talent to limit the Rice offense throughout the game. With the 5-for-5 eligibility rule now in effect, the Irish plan to utilize a broader range of depth players early in the contest. The coaching staff intends to distribute targets among Mylan Graham, Greathouse, and Gilbert to test the offense's capability to operate beyond the established primary receivers.
